Output 51ea31d26babdbd5854a70085ad87f0e09ac998418fd45434b5dda727864f730:0

value
68773948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6995d87afdaf8d3442842fe0468efa38427f544e OP_EQUAL
address
MHXSh2dyd8qdzsia58r9yY6D1oqhHjzqeZ
transaction
51ea31d26babdbd5854a70085ad87f0e09ac998418fd45434b5dda727864f730
spent
true